1. Dublin Castle Photo © The Irish Road Trip Dublin Castle is the only castle in Dublin City in this guide. You'll find it on Dame Street where it sits on the site of a Viking Fortress that was here in the 930s. The fortress was actually the Viking's primary military base and it was a key trading centre for the slave trade in Ireland.

Howth Castle With its Gate Tower and Keep that date from the 15th century, Howth Castle is an example of how historic houses have evolved in Ireland through the centuries. Howth Castle is the home of the St Lawrence's since 1177.

1. Dublin Castle The seat of the British government's administration in Ireland for more than 700 years, until 1922, most of what remains of Dublin Castle is from the 18th century though the Record Tower aka the Wardrobe Tower dates as far back as 1258.

There are few castles in Ireland with a location that's as mighty as Glenveagh Castle in Donegal. Built between 1867 and 1873, Glenveagh Castle is finely placed on the shores of Lough Veagh. The castle's location was inspired by the Victorian idyll of a romantic highland retreat and you'll find it surrounded by mountains in Glenveagh National Park.
